Job summary
The role involves working closely with and supporting the Practice Manager in the day-to-day operations of the practice ensuring that in addition to oneself, the wider staff team are supported in fulfilling their responsibilities by providing leadership, management and guidance.
Main duties of the job
The Deputy Practice Manager is a critical role within the Senior Management Team (SMT). The SMT is led by the Practice Manager and consists of the Deputy Practice Manager, a Data Specialist Manager, a Finance Manager, and a Patient Services Manager. Managers with large teams are supported by Team Leaders within their respective departments. The Deputy Practice Manager will be expected to deputise for the Practice Manager in their absence.
Some flexibility is required, as you may sometimes need to work additional or alternative hours to cover for colleagues.
About us
We are a long-established practice with approximately 22,000 patients. We are a very friendly team comprising of 54 staff members serving patients across Biggleswade, Sandy, Langford and the surrounding areas.

Job description
Job responsibilities
SPECIFICS
Regulation and Compliance
Implement systems to ensure compliance with CQC regulations and standards
Staff
Review and update staff job descriptions and person specifications, ensuring all staff are legally and gainfully employed
Act as the administrative lead for recruitment, including placing adverts and conducting pre-employment and DBS checks
Organise and oversee staff induction programmes, periodically reviewing them for effectiveness and making recommendations for updates as required
Manage the annual in-house staff survey process
Undertake regular supervision meetings and annual appraisals with line managed staff
Lead on practice team wellbeing initiatives
Lead on organising practice team events, such as the Christmas party
Lead on organising annual face-to-face Basic Life Support training for the clinical team
Oversee and maintain training records for the practice team
Support the Practice Manager with the effective management of disciplinary and grievance issues
Identify training needs and delivering training where appropriate
Work with and support the PCN Training Lead by suggesting topics for internal training for non-clinical staff delivered in protected learning time
Information & Technology
Lead on the management of the clinical system (SystmOne), including ensuring IT security and information governance compliance, and responding to and resolving local IT issues
Work with the PCN Digital & Transformation Lead to manage the practices communications channels (e.g. website and social media)
Develop searches, reports and audits on the clinical system (SystmOne), as required
Review and update clinical templates ensuring they remain current
Premises
Manage supplier contracts (e.g. cleaning, consumable supplies etc), including contract renewals, and deal with any issues that arise
Manage a budget for purchases of consumables and equipment
Manage supplier contracts (e.g. cleaning, utilities, insurances etc), including performance management, renewals and sourcing best value
Oversee the work of and provide support to the Facilities Supervisor
Manage premises health and safety, undertaking risk assessments and mandatory training as required
Service Delivery and Development
Manage DNAs, including identifying patients who repeatedly DNA and devising solutions to reduce occurrences
Participate in production of practice development plans
Review, update and roll out the latest version of the practice Business Continuity Plan annually, or sooner if required.
Undertake Data Protection Impact Assessments for new services and processes
Participate in planning and roll out of new services and processes
Provide colleagues with support to ensure effective the delivery of services
Monitor and disseminate information on safety alerts and other information relevant for the wider team
Lead in providing support to the practices Patient Participation Group
Together with the Practice Manager attend meetings such as monthly practice SMT meetings, weekly PCN managers meetings and monthly Partnership meetings
General
Be an integral, proactive member of the practice team, leading by example
Adhere to practice policies, protocols and procedure.
Undertake mandatory training
Support and participate in shared learning
Undertake any other reasonable duties as directed by the Practice Manager

Person Specification
Experience
Essential
* Experience of working in primary care or general practice
* Experience of line management and leading a team
* Experience of developing and implementing projects
* Experience of developing and rolling out policies and protocols
* Knowledge of the regulatory frameworks governing general practice (e.g CQC, GMS contract)
* Excellent literacy and numeracy skills
* Excellent communication skills, including the ability to communicate effectively with people from a wide range of backgrounds
* Confident working with IT and learning new systems
* Strong, people-centred leadership skills
* Ability to prioritise, delegate and work to tight deadlines in a fast-paced environment
* Ability to remain positive and calm when under pressure
Desirable
* Ability to think strategically
* Experience of negotiating best value with suppliers and managing supplier contracts
* Knowledge of health and safety at work regulations
